BlackRock Capital Investment Corporation focuses on providing debt and equity investments primarily in middle-market companies across various sectors in the United States. Its competitive position is bolstered by a strong management team and a diversified investment portfolio that allows it to capitalize on favorable market conditions.
The company generates revenue primarily through interest income from its debt investments in middle-market companies, complemented by dividend income from equity investments. Its competitive advantages include a strong brand reputation, extensive network, and access to proprietary deal flow, which enhance its ability to identify and execute profitable investments.
